Jenkintown
Jenkintown is a charming, historic borough known for its vibrant arts scene, distinctive architecture, and tight-knit community.
Notable landmarks include the Jenkins’ Town Lyceum Building and the Strawbridge and Clothier Store, both listed on the National Register of Historic Places.
The borough is also home to the Jenkintown-Wyncote SEPTA station, a major regional rail hub.
